Hi, could someone help me? I'm trying to link several DAWs together (audio wise). I've installed JACK virtual cable. Everything works as expected except that Waveform has only four outputs assigned. I would need more. I can't find where to set the number of outputs in Waveform or JACK. Please, can someone help me? Thanks!

We're talking about https://jackaudio.org/
I believe, it should serve as a virtual audio cable within your computer. Yes, the final outs count is defined by HW. But internally - between each DAW - there should be any number of 'cables' available. Mixbus32c creates new ins/outs as I create new tracks. But Waveform stays at 4, no matter what.

Thank you! Unfortunately, there is no binary to download for Windows, and I'm not able to build one by myself (if it's even possible). But I found a workaround. I can set the default outputs number in the JACK ini file, so Waveform now opens with the set number of outputs, which works just fine (for now) :-D
